Government presents action plan against honor-related violence and forced marriage in Norway

Guri MelbyPhoto: Håkon Mosvold Larsen / NTB

On Wednesday, Minister of Education and Integration Guri Melby (V) is presenting a new action plan with five different focus areas and 33 measures against negative social control.

“The freedom to decide over one’s own life is fundamental in our society. All people have the right to live their lives in freedom from negative social control, honor-related violence, forced marriage, and female genital mutilation,” Melby noted in a press release.

The five focus areas in the action plan include, among other measures, efforts aimed at newly arrived refugees and immigrants, strengthened legal protection for vulnerable people, prevention of involuntary stays abroad, and international cooperation.

“Negative social control and honor-related violence can be barriers to integration. It is important that prevention starts early and takes place in several areas,” Melby emphasized.
